Samuel Macleod is a Senior System Engineer based in London with eight years of experience building and maintaining cloud-native tooling and developer-facing systems. At Cloudflare he has worked across full-stack and backend areas, notably improving the Cloudflare Docs site with Vite-driven refactors and contributing npm publishing and build automation for the workerd JavaScript/Wasm runtime. He combines systems thinking with front-end polish—shipping dynamic learning-path components and developer conveniences like code-copy and example playground links. His background spans product internships and community technical roles in student radio and webmastering, reflecting both product sensitivity and operational discipline. A mathematics graduate from the University of Edinburgh, he brings a data-minded approach to reliable builds and reproducible developer workflows. Peers would describe him as an engineer who quietly improves developer experience and CI/CD plumbing rather than seeking the spotlight.

Contributions summary:Samuel's contributions focus on establishing the foundational npm publishing scripts, specifically for the JavaScript / Wasm runtime "workerd". The changes include the implementation of scripts to install and manage dependencies using npm, download necessary binaries, and automate version bumping. Furthermore, modifications in `server.c++` and `npm.sh` suggest active involvement in the build and integration processes of this runtime environment.

Contributions summary:Samuel primarily focused on improving the Cloudflare documentation site. Their work involved refactoring the build and development setup using Vite, integrating new components, and enhancing existing ones, such as the dynamic learning path and code copy features. They also addressed issues in the build process and example code. The user also made improvements to the website's styling and generated playground links for the examples provided.
